The Growth Foundation is seeking a dynamic Account Manager in Greater London to develop and manage key premium retail and wholesale partnerships. This role is vital for driving revenue and enhancing brand presence in leading retail environments.
The ideal candidate will have 3-5 years' experience in account management, preferably within FMCG or beauty sectors, and will possess strong forecasting and stakeholder management skills.
